There are approximately 137,000 people currently living in Elmbridge. The 40-59 age range makes up the majority of the population. Unemployment in the area (4.7%) is high compared to the United Kingdom as a whole (4%). The labour force represents 77.8% of the local population, or 63,600 people. Elmbridge has an average annual income of £57,013, which is significantly higher than the national average salary of £30,629.
